Output 122bbee614c82fc4c088e6ae04edde40e85f80a602401d4dfe9c47e551bb26de:1

value
24161156
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d9faa72d5da93563c9d0462316e5c1616e330cc OP_EQUALVERIFY OP_CHECKSIG
address
1MCqcArGcUFKrZcDgdG4qEX2KPcstGks5w
transaction
122bbee614c82fc4c088e6ae04edde40e85f80a602401d4dfe9c47e551bb26de
spent
true